Zions' $50M Loan Loss Sparks Concerns, Hits Regional Bank Stocks

Zions Bancorporation reported a $50 million loan loss, impacting regional banks. Concerns about credit risks are growing among investors and analysts. JPMorgan's CEO has issued warnings regarding the regional banking sector.
